liblilv-dev: library for simple use of LV2 plugins (development files)

 Lilv (formerly SLV2) is a library for LV2 hosts intended to make using
 LV2 Plugins as simple as possible (without sacrificing capabilities).
 .
 Lilv is the successor to SLV2, rewritten to be significantly faster
 and have minimal dependencies.
 .
 This package provides the development files.

lilv-utils: library for simple use of LV2 plugins (runtime files)

 Lilv (formerly SLV2) is a library for LV2 hosts intended to make using
 LV2 Plugins as simple as possible (without sacrificing capabilities).
 .
 Lilv is the successor to SLV2, rewritten to be significantly faster
 and have minimal dependencies.
 .
 This package provides the following utilities:
  * lv2info - Extract information about an LV2 plugin.
  * lv2ls - List all installed LV2 plugins.
